为了账号安全,请及时绑定邮箱和手机立即绑定

看不懂这个函数?为什么要把name定义成world

看不懂这个函数?为什么要把name定义成world

def greet(name="world"):
    print 'Hello,'+ name + '.


正在回答

2 回答

name相当于变量,里面有参数world对吧

0 回复 有任何疑惑可以回复我~

是吧world赋值给name,你这样记忆,在括号里面被赋了值的变量就是默认参数,也就是在这种情况下,你不传入该参数,它就会显示那个被赋的值(比如这个地方就是默认显示world)

3 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
初识Python
  • 参与学习       758621    人
  • 解答问题       8667    个

学python入门视频教程,让你快速入门并能编写简单的Python程序

进入课程

看不懂这个函数?为什么要把name定义成world

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信